Make sure never to update the control register with random data (an
error code) by checking the return value after reading it.

Signed-off-by: Johan Hovold <jo...@kernel.org>
---
 drivers/net/phy/micrel.c | 6 ++++++
 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+)

diff --git a/drivers/net/phy/micrel.c b/drivers/net/phy/micrel.c
index bcc6c0ea75fa..62ca9613a514 100644
--- a/drivers/net/phy/micrel.c
+++ b/drivers/net/phy/micrel.c
@@ -122,6 +122,8 @@ static int kszphy_config_intr(struct phy_device *phydev)
 
        /* set the interrupt pin active low */
        temp = phy_read(phydev, MII_KSZPHY_CTRL);
+       if (temp < 0)
+               return temp;
        temp &= ~KSZPHY_CTRL_INT_ACTIVE_HIGH;
        phy_write(phydev, MII_KSZPHY_CTRL, temp);
        rc = kszphy_set_interrupt(phydev);
@@ -134,6 +136,8 @@ static int ksz9021_config_intr(struct phy_device *phydev)
 
        /* set the interrupt pin active low */
        temp = phy_read(phydev, MII_KSZPHY_CTRL);
+       if (temp < 0)
+               return temp;
        temp &= ~KSZ9021_CTRL_INT_ACTIVE_HIGH;
        phy_write(phydev, MII_KSZPHY_CTRL, temp);
        rc = kszphy_set_interrupt(phydev);
@@ -146,6 +150,8 @@ static int ks8737_config_intr(struct phy_device *phydev)
 
        /* set the interrupt pin active low */
        temp = phy_read(phydev, MII_KSZPHY_CTRL);
+       if (temp < 0)
+               return temp;
        temp &= ~KS8737_CTRL_INT_ACTIVE_HIGH;
        phy_write(phydev, MII_KSZPHY_CTRL, temp);
        rc = kszphy_set_interrupt(phydev);
